A Return to Player (RTP) percentage indicates the amount of money a game theoretically returns to players over a protracted period. A 98% RTP in chicken road game is exceptionally high. This means, on average, for every $100 wagered, the game will return $98 to players in winnings. While individual results will vary due to the inherent randomness of the game, the high RTP positions Chicken Road as an extraordinarily attractive option for players seeking favorable odds. This high figure isn’t merely a marketing tactic; it’s a key element of the game’s design, aiming to provide a competitive edge.
It’s important to note that RTP doesn’t guarantee a win on every spin, but it sets a benchmark for long-term profitability for the player. Factors like volatility also play a role; a high RTP game with high volatility might have less frequent but larger payouts, while a lower volatility game would provide more consistent, smaller wins.
